A versatile and successful Line producer and Directors Guild of America Production manager who has realized 14 feature films, 1 miniseries, and 5 documentaries, and has done a variety of work for Paramount, Warner Bros., Buena Vista, Showtime, HBO, Capella, Republic, Zoetrope, Mirage and a number of independent production companies. These film projects have appeared on major networks and as theatrical releases, museums and film festivals worldwide. His latest film, "Pavilion of Women," has been selected to represent Universal Studio at the year 2000 Cannes Film Festival
Expertise includes negotiations with agents and unions, breakdowns and budgets, casting, supervision of pre-production, production including camera operator, special effects (mechanical and CGI, arms and pyrotechnics), post-production, and management of delivery elements for domestic and foreign releases. He has worked in North and South America, Asia, Europe, and the United States.

Co-Owner of Partners & Partners, a Trans-Pacific company, Taiwan. (1987-1989) Started an animation studio and developed animation projects with related merchandise products for world-wide distribution.
Co-Owner of Dasher Communications, San Francisco. (1984-1987) A production company servicing the advertising community. Clients included Foote, Cone & Belding, Levi Strauss, and Coppola Communications. Developed, produced and directed industrial film/theater and multi-media seminars as well as creating corporate images, developing print and television advertising campaigns, and related collateral materials for Bank of America, Hewlett Packard, Memorex, Fujitsu, Pacific Telesis, and Multi Optics.
Professor, San Francisco Art Institute, (1977-1984) Taught special effects, animation and film production, undergraduate and graduate levels.
